Best for designers building scalable systems
Eugene Fedorenko is a self-taught product designer and frontend developer with two decades of experience creating tools for software developers. Deeply involved in the Figma community, he built custom plugins and curates a regular digest of design resources. His passion for high-quality software and hands-on expertise uniquely position him to guide you through mastering Figma's reusable components and styles. This book reflects Eugene's commitment to helping designers build future-proof, scalable design systems with practical insights drawn from his extensive career.
2020·164 pages·Figma, Design, User Interface, Components, Auto Layout

During his extensive career supporting software developers, Eugene Fedorenko discovered how challenging it is to master Figma beyond the basics. His book walks you through creating flexible layouts using Frames and Auto Layout, building reusable Component systems with inheritance and versioning, and managing Styles effectively across projects. You'll learn why Vector Networks and Figma's Pen Tool differ fundamentally from other design apps and how to automate asset exports while handling real data integrations through plugins and the Figma API. This guide suits designers eager to elevate their workflows and build scalable, adaptable design systems rather than just dabbling in the tool's surface features.

Best for mobile developers improving UI/UX
The raywenderlich Tutorial Team is composed of skilled developers and designers dedicated to helping learners improve mobile app development and design skills. Their collaborative experience and commitment to quality teaching underpin this book, which guides you through designing modern mobile apps using Figma. Their expertise ensures the book covers essential design principles with practical examples, making it a valuable resource for developers aiming to enhance their UI and UX capabilities.
App Design Apprentice (First Edition): A Non-Designer’s Guide to Better Mobile UI and UX book cover

by raywenderlich Tutorial Team, Prateek Prasad··You?

2021·281 pages·Mobile Design, Figma, Design, User Experience, Wireframing

While working as a team of experienced developers and designers, the raywenderlich Tutorial Team created this guide to help intermediate mobile developers master app design with Figma. You’ll learn how to analyze top apps through teardowns, build reusable UI components, and apply typography and color principles to enhance clarity and hierarchy. The book also covers transitions, animations, and design systems tailored for iOS and Android ecosystems. If you’re familiar with coding mobile apps but want to improve your design skills without getting overwhelmed, this provides a clear path to creating visually appealing and user-friendly interfaces.
